optional 和 required (proto2) vs. 默认值 (proto3): 在proto3中,所有字段默认都是optional的,这意味着它们可以不被设置。
错误处理: 添加了file_get_contents和json_decode的错误检查,这在生产环境中至关重要,可以帮助诊断文件读取或JSON格式问题。
'fr', 'fr_FR', ...: 这些是区域语言环境的标识符。
Go语言运行时在平衡性能和实现复杂性后,选择了使用锁来保证通道的健壮性和正确性。
4. 使用 itertools.chain()itertools.chain() 是一个非常强大的工具,特别适用于合并大量列表或迭代器,因为它返回一个迭代器,而不是一次性构建整个合并后的列表。
如果文件不存在或内容为空,则返回一个空列表。
合理使用PHPCS能显著提升代码质量,配合CI流程还能实现提交前自动检查,避免低级错误流入主干。
根据每页10条数据,偏移量=(当前页-1)×每页数量,使用LIMIT跳过已显示数据。
通义灵码 阿里云出品的一款基于通义大模型的智能编码辅助工具,提供代码智能生成、研发智能问答能力 31 查看详情 常用的 ANSI 转义码正则表达式模式: re.compile(r'\x1b\[[0-?]*[ -/]*[@-~]') 这个模式的解释如下: \x1b: 匹配 ASCII 转义字符 (Escape)。
操作步骤: 导入ElementTree模块 加载XML字符串或文件 遍历元素,调用attrib属性获取所有属性字典 示例代码: import xml.etree.ElementTree as ET data = '''<book id="101" category="fiction" author="Liu">Python Guide</book>''' root = ET.fromstring(data) print(root.attrib) # 输出:{'id': '101', 'category': 'fiction', 'author': 'Liu'} 单独获取某个属性 book_id = root.get('id') print(book_id) # 输出:101 使用Java解析XML属性(DOM方式) Java中可以通过DOM解析器读取XML文档,并访问元素的属性。
2.2 实现步骤与代码 以下是实现这一功能的JavaScript代码:// 确保在DOM加载完成后执行 document.addEventListener('DOMContentLoaded', () => { // 1. 获取包含所有筛选器的表单 let filterForm = document.querySelector("form.filterform"); // 仅当表单存在时才执行后续逻辑 if (null !== filterForm) { // 2. 设置一个定时器,等待滑块元素完全加载和初始化 // 某些滑块库可能在DOM加载后异步初始化,此等待机制确保能找到滑块句柄。
在PHP开发中,数据库操作是核心环节之一。
它允许你一边从数据库或远程服务获取数据,一边逐步处理,而不是等待全部结果返回。
target_path_pattern = '/Workspace/Users/your_username/*.json': 定义一个包含通配符的文件路径模式。
为了快速定位这些瓶颈,可以使用Xhprof进行性能分析。
注意事项与总结 平台依赖性: --no-xlib参数主要针对Linux系统,特别是那些可能没有完整X Window System支持或存在特定Xlib交互问题的环境(如Raspberry Pi)。
设置SPF和DKIM记录: SPF(Sender Policy Framework)和DKIM(DomainKeys Identified Mail)是两种邮件身份验证技术,可以防止邮件欺骗,提高邮件的可信度。
方法一:使用os.path.exists() Python标准库中的os.path模块提供了一系列用于路径操作的函数,其中os.path.exists(path)是判断指定路径是否存在的最常用方法。
" . PHP_EOL; exit(1); } echo "模拟掷骰子 " . $numRolls . " 次的结果:" . PHP_EOL; // 使用 for 循环生成指定数量的随机数 for ($i = 0; $i < $numRolls; $i++) { // 生成1到6之间的随机整数,模拟骰子点数 $diceRoll = random_int(1, 6); echo $diceRoll . " "; // 输出每次掷骰子的结果 } echo PHP_EOL; // 输出一个换行符,使结果更整洁 ?>代码解析: 命令行参数处理: $argc 变量存储命令行参数的数量。
通常,它作为GCC工具链的一部分提供。
本文链接:http://www.buchi-mdr.com/27387_598b8a.html